Paea Spies / 'Oku sio 'a Paea by Dahlia Malaeulu is a delightful bilingual book where Paea enjoys playing games with her friends, introducing readers to Tongan colours through a fun game of 'I spy'. It includes two stories in one book: Paea Spies offers scaffolded language support while 'Oku sio 'a Paea presents the Tongan translation.

Based on the first Mila's My Gagana Series (2019), these dual language stories enable readers to explore the target language confidently, helping to develop understanding and cultural confidence. The Mila's My Pasifika Series stories are culturally rich picture books that provide safe language learning opportunities.

About the Author

Dahlia Malaeulu is an award-winning author and publisher of Mila's Books - Pasifika children's books that help tamaiti to be seen, heard and valued. A Samoan New Zealander with connections to the Samoan villages of Vaivase tai and Sinamoga, Dahlia is a passionate educator at heart driven by the power of Pasifika stories and enabling tamaiti to succeed as themselves. Dahlia also regularly presents at educational conferences, visits schools across Aotearoa, was the Pasifika Curator at the Auckland Writer's festival this year, the recipient of the Creative New Zealand Pasifika Emerging Pacific Artist Award (2022), the NZ Emerging Publisher Award (2023) and serves on the Te Pou Muramura Read New Zealand board.
